How Common Is The Last Name Bawali? popularity and diffusion
Bawali is the 128,555th most frequently used family name globally, borne by approximately 1 in 2,067,389 people. The surname Bawali occurs mostly in Asia, where 95 percent of Bawali live; 95 percent live in South Asia and 67 percent live in Indo-South Asia. Bawali is also the 787,636th most frequently occurring given name worldwide, borne by 138 people.
The surname is most numerous in India, where it is carried by 2,351 people, or 1 in 326,272. In India it is most numerous in: West Bengal, where 77 percent live, Andaman and Nicobar Islands, where 11 percent live and Odisha, where 10 percent live. Beside India this last name is found in 12 countries. It is also found in Bangladesh, where 26 percent live and Pakistan, where 2 percent live.
